Six students from Catholic schools around Melbourne have been hard at work this week planning articles for the Spring edition and learning about publishing on our media internship program.

The students are spending a week at the Australian Catholics offices in Melbourne, working with editors Michael McVeigh and Fr Andrew Hamilton SJ, and learning from professionals in the field.

Our guest editors for the youth edition are:

Elise Ho – St Aloysius College, North Melbourne

Kyla Dwyer – Kilbreda College, Mentone

Abbey Maffescioni – St Ignatius College, Geelong

Chiara Fankhauser – St Ignatius College, Geelong

Mieke de Vries – Avila College, Mt Waverley

Beatrice van Rest – Avila College, Mt Waverley

This year’s youth edition is focusing on ‘Family’, and the students have been planning and writing a range of articles exploring the theme.

Keep an eye out for the edition, which will be out in late August.
